Instrument Rating Theory
The Instrument Rating Theory (IFR) courses cover the full NZCAA syllabus (AC 61) for the theory portion of an Instrument Rating. IFR Law, IFR Flight Navigation, and IFR Instruments and Navaids. Meteorology and Human Factors are covered in the CPL courses for CPL pilots. For pilots with a PPL licence you can do the new IFR - Operational Knowledge course. All courses include short tests and practice exams to prepare you for the NZCAA Exams.

IFR
Operational Knowledge
This course covers the AC 61 Subject 53 - IR Operational Knowledge syllabus for New Zealand pilots. This subject and exam is for PPL holders who wish to get an instrument rating. It covers all subjects including Meteorology and Human Factors syllabus items. Pilots that hold a CPL Licence cover Met and Human Factors in the CPL theory exams.
